THE THREE QUESTIONS
What earns a place on the shelf
We ask the same three questions of every entry, in order. The answers must, where possible, be in numbers.
I.
Ten-year lifespan
Can it serve, kindly treated, for ten years? Warranty years, parts availability, repair coverage — checked in numbers.
II.
The three-fold good
Cost per year for the buyer, continuity for the maker, kWh and kgCO₂ for the world. We avoid the language of SDGs in favour of measurable facts.
III.
The hundred-year question
A hundred years from now, will a reader still recognise this as careful work? It is an unforgiving question. That is its purpose.
CURATORIAL PROCESS
How an entry reaches the shelf
- 01
Research, primary sources
Manufacturer warranty figures, third-party test results, company longevity records, LCA where available. Sources are cited inside each entry.
- 02
AI-assisted drafting
A local model (Ollama / Qwen family) drafts structure according to the three-question framework. Brand and product names are only introduced once an editor has verified them.
- 03
Editor verification + lived use
A human editor verifies numbers against primary sources and adds first-hand observations from long use. AI cannot supply a decade of wear; we can.
- 04
Catalogued · Revised · Withdrawn
After cataloguing, the entry is revised on specification changes, after long re-evaluation, or when its maker drifts from its earlier standards. When that happens, the entry is withdrawn with the reason recorded in the log of revisions.
